Marquette County, WI falls within the normal range for household financial distress at 35.1 — 2469th nationally out of 3144 counties. The primary driver is Legal Distress, where bankruptcy filing rates are well above the national average. Within Wisconsin, it ranks 22nd of 72 counties. Among its 4 neighboring counties, 3 show more distress.
The Numbers Behind the Score
The CDI measures five statistically derived factors of household financial distress, PCA-weighted. Marquette County's primary driver is Legal Distress at 76.7 — worse than roughly 77% of U.S. counties.
Scores are percentile-based: 50 = national median, higher = more distressed.
